Title :
Novel dual band hybrid rat-race coupler with CRLH and D-CRLH transmission lines

Abstract :
A new dual band rat-race coupler with left handed transmission lines is presented in this paper. The main advantage of this novel coupler is that there are used a reduced number of cells, meanwhile the performances improve. In order to reduce the dimensions of the coupler, the 3λ/4 CRLH transmission line has been replaced with a D-CRLH transmission line, and moreover there have been introduced a new method to design quarter wavelengths CRLH/D-CRLH transmission lines with minimum number of cells. Also, the dual version of this hybrid coupler, that is made of three identical CRLH transmission lines and one D-CRLH is the hybrid coupler that has three identical D-CRLH transmission lines and only one CRLH transmission line. In fact, the main idea of the hybrid rat-race coupler is to use the duality between the CRLH and D-CRLH transmission lines, which implies in this particular case, to replace a transmission line that introduces a phase shift of 2700° with a transmission line introducing a phase shift of -90°, and vice versa. It is important to notice, that this coupler can be designed to operate at two arbitrary frequencies like all microwave devices that use LH transmission lines.
